Frosted Carrot Cake Bars for Quick Potluck Desserts

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 24 bars 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Delicious and moist carrot cake bars topped with a creamy frosting, perfect for potlucks and gatherings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up vegetable oil
  • 4 large eggs
  • 3 cups grated carrots
  • 1 cup crushed pineapple, drained
  • 1 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13 inch baking pan.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ix the oil and eggs until well combined.
  4.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, mixing until just combined.
  5. Fold in the grated carrots, crushed pineapple, and walnuts if using.
  6.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read evenly.
  7.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  8. Let the bars cool completely in the pan.
  9. For the frosting, beat together the cream cheese and butter until smooth.
  10. Gradually add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ract, mixing until creamy.
  11. Spread the frosting over the cooled carrot cake bars.
  12. Cut into squares and serve.

Notes

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
  • These bars can be made a day in advance for convenience.
  • Feel free to add raisins or coconut for extra flavor.
